About this Exam

The Midwifery and Women’s Health Nurse Practitioner (WHNP) certifications represent the pinnacle of dedication to female reproductive health and primary care across the lifespan. These distinct yet closely related certifications validate a nurse’s advanced knowledge, clinical skills, and entry-level competency to practice safely and effectively.

Specialized certification exams, typically administered by the American Midwifery Certification Board (AMCB) for midwives (CNM/CM) and the National Certification Corporation (NCC) for WHNPs, ensure that practitioners meet rigorous national standards. What the Course Entails and Exam Details

To prepare for these certification exams, candidates must possess a deep understanding of comprehensive advanced practice nursing, focusing heavily on the specific needs of women from adolescence through menopause and beyond. While the specific syllabus varies slightly between the Midwifery and WHNP pathways, both require mastery of core content areas, including gynecology, obstetrics (antepartum, intrapartum, postpartum, and newborn care for midwives), primary care, and pharmacology specific to women’s health.

The exams also heavily emphasize professional issues, legal and ethical considerations in healthcare, and the application of evidence-based research to clinical practice. The "course" of study involves applying theoretical knowledge gained in graduate programs to complex clinical scenarios, testing your ability to diagnose, manage conditions, and promote wellness.

 

 

 What to Expect in the Final Exam

Walking into the final certification exam, candidates should expect a computer-based testing (CBT) experience consisting primarily of multiple-choice questions designed to test clinical decision-making skills. For the AMCB (Midwifery) exam, candidates typically face around 175 questions within a four-hour time limit.

The NCC (WHNP) exam is similar in structure, though the exact number of questions and time allocation may vary slightly depending on the specific test form; both exams use varying passing scores based on psychometrics equating, rather than a fixed percentage. Candidates must be prepared to synthesize data quickly, apply critical thinking, and possess a thorough understanding of normal physiological processes as well as common pathologies. There are strict security protocols at testing centers, and specific identification requirements must be met to sit for the examination.

 

 

How to Study and Exam Centers

Effective study strategies go beyond rote memorization; you must practice active recall and apply concepts to clinical situations. Incorporating timed practice exams into your study routine is perhaps the most effective method, as it builds testing stamina, highlights knowledge gaps, and familiarizes you with the phrasing of certification-style questions.

Create a structured study plan that dedicates specific times to high-yield topics, utilizes diverse resources like current textbooks, clinical guidelines from organizations like ACOG and ACNM, and professional review courses. When you are ready to take the actual exam, both the AMCB and NCC utilize specialized, secure testing centers, such as Pearson VUE, which are located throughout the United States and internationally. Once your application is approved, you will receive an authorization to test (ATT), which allows you to schedule your specific exam date and location directly through the testing vendor's online portal.

 

 

Job Opportunities from the Course

Earning certification as a Certified Nurse-Midwife (CNM), Certified Midwife (CM), or Women’s Health Nurse Practitioner (WHNP) opens doors to a diverse range of rewarding career paths in various clinical settings. These certified professionals are in high demand and can pursue roles such as:

  • Women’s Health Nurse Practitioner (WHNP-BC) in private practices, OB/GYN clinics, or public health settings.
  • Certified Nurse-Midwife (CNM) providing comprehensive prenatal, birth, and postpartum care in hospitals, birth centers, or home settings.
  • Primary Care Provider for Women in community health centers or federal facilities.
  • Fertility and Reproductive Endocrinology Specialist.
  • Urogynecology Nurse Practitioner.
  • Clinical Educator or Faculty Member in nursing education programs.
  • Maternal-Fetal Medicine (MFM) clinical coordinator.
  • Hospitalist focusing on OB/GYN triage and inpatient care.
